Maple Grove pricing

Water heater repair cost by part.

Typical Maple Grove repair pricing including parts and labor. A diagnostic fee usually applies and is often credited toward the work.

In Maple Grove, water heater repair costs typically range from $175 to $750 for common repairs, plus a diagnostic fee of $85 to $225. Most homes were built around 1991, so many water heaters are reaching or past their expected lifespan, especially in this cold northern climate where incoming water is very cold. Repairs often involve gas units, as gas is the predominant fuel type locally. Minnesota requires a permit for water heater work; homeowners can pull their own permit only if they live in the home, otherwise a licensed contractor is needed. The 2020 Minnesota Plumbing Code (based on 2018 UPC) applies, and expansion tanks are required on closed systems.

What Maple Grove code requires

Replacing a water heater in Maple Grove follows Minnesota rules under the Uniform Plumbing Code (UPC) - 2020 Minnesota Plumbing Code based on 2018 UPC. Here’s what applies statewide:

  • Permit

    Pulled by your licensed plumber; covers gas/venting and the expansion tank.

    Required
  • Seismic strapping

    No state strapping mandate — one less line on the bill.

    Not required
  • Expansion tank

    Required where a pressure regulator or backflow preventer is present.

    Required on closed systems
  • Plumbing code
    Uniform Plumbing Code (UPC) - 2020 Minnesota Plumbing Code based on 2018 UPC
  • Good to know

    Homeowners may pull their own water-heater plumbing permit only for a home they homestead (live in); otherwise a state-licensed plumbing contractor is required.

What moves the price

What Influences Repair Costs in Maple Grove

Labor rates reflect the area's high median income ($127,001) and the need for licensed plumbers. The cold winter inlet water can accelerate tank corrosion, leading to more frequent repairs. Permit costs and the requirement for an expansion tank on closed systems add to the total. The type of repair—whether it's a simple thermostat replacement or a more complex gas valve fix—also affects pricing. Homes built in 1991 may have older plumbing that requires extra care.

Common Water Heater Repairs in Maple Grove

1

No Hot Water

Often due to a failed heating element in electric units or a faulty thermocouple in gas units, common in older homes.

2

Leaking Tank

Corrosion from cold inlet water and sediment buildup can cause leaks, especially in tanks over 10 years old.

3

Rumbling or Popping Noises

Sediment accumulation at the bottom of the tank, more frequent with hard water, causes overheating and noise.

What to expect

What to Expect During a Water Heater Repair in Maple Grove

A licensed plumber will first diagnose the issue, often charging a fee of $85–$225. They will check the gas supply, pilot light, thermostat, and tank for leaks. If a permit is needed, they will handle it unless you are a homeowner pulling your own. Repairs typically take 1–3 hours. After repair, they will test the unit and ensure it meets local code, including the expansion tank requirement.
